EGTA滴定法测定硅钙钡合金中的钙、钡  

Determination of Ca and Ba in Si-Ca-Ba Alloy with EGTA Titrimetric Method

摘  要:试样以硝酸一氢氟酸溶解,高氯酸冒烟除尽硅和氟,用稀盐酸溶解盐类后制取母液。分取母液两份,分别以三乙醇胺半胱氨酸联合掩蔽铁等干扰元素,以氢氧化钾调节pH≥13后,第一份以钙黄绿素为指示剂,用EGTA标准落液滴定钙钡合量,另一份以硫酸钾沉淀钡后,用EGTA标准溶液滴定钙量,用差减法计算钡的百分含量。测定结果显示,钙相对标准偏差<0.31%,钡相对标准偏差<0.37%。The sample was dissolved with nitrate acid and hydrofluoric acid,accedes to perchloric acid and heated until emitting thick fume,the silicon and fluoride was removed.The remaining liquid which contains rich salts was dissolved with dilute hydrochloric acid,was prepared the mother solution for analysis.Two parts was taken from mother solution,after masking the interferences such as Fe through combining triethanolamine and cysteine and the solution was regulated to ph≥13 by KOH respectively.The first part was used to determine the total content of Ca and Ba with EGTA standard solution titrimetric method with calcein as indicator,another part was used to determine the content of Ca with EGTA standard solution titrimetric method after the Ba was precipitated by potassium sulfate.The content of Ba was calculated with subtraction method.The test results show that the deviation of Ca is less than 0.31%,and the deviation of Ba is less than 0.37%.
